We are given the coordinates of the vertices of a triangle, and asked to find the parameters of the perpendicular bisectors of the sides of the triangle. The perpendicular bisectors are to be plotted on the graph.
Given:Coordinates A(1, 6), B(5, 4), C(5, -2)
__
Find:a) Graph and label the triangle
b) Find the midpoint of each side of the triangle
c) Find the slope of each side of the triangle
d) Find the slope of each perpendicular bisector
e) Use the midpoint and the perpendicular slope to accurately draw each perpendicular bisector on the triangle
__
Solution:a)See the attached graph for shaded triangle ABC.
__
b)The midpoint (M) of a segment AB will be ...
M = (A+B)/2
For example, the midpoint of segment AB is ...
D = ((1, 6) +(5, 4))/2 = (1+5, 6+4)/2 = (6, 10)/2 = (3, 5)
This repetitive arithmetic is carried out in the spreadsheet shown in the second attachment. The midpoints are ...
D(3, 5) is midpoint of AB
E(5, 1) is midpoint of BC
F(3, 2) is midpoint of CA
__
c)The slope of a segment is found using the slope formula (or by counting grid squares). That formula is ...
m = (y2 -y1)/(x2 -x1)
For segment AB, this is ...
mAB = (4 -6)/(5 -1) = -2/4 = -1/2
The other slopes are calculated similarly in the spreadsheet. When the denominator is zero (a vertical line), the slope is "undefined."
mBC = undefined
mCA = -2
__
d)The slope of the perpendicular line is the opposite reciprocal of the slope of the segment.
m⟂AB = -1/(-1/2) = 2
m⟂BC = 0 . . . . . a horizontal line has 0 slope
m⟂CA = -1/-2 = 1/2
__
e)The perpendicular bisectors of each of the sides of the triangle are shown in the first attachment. As the lesson title indicates, their point of concurrency is G(1, 1), the circumcenter of the triangle.

Please can someone who knows the right answer help me? From a group of 5 boys and 3 girls, a boy and a girl will be selected to attend a conference. In how many ways can the select be made?
The selection can be made in 15 different ways, taking into account the distinct combinations of a boy and a girl from the given group of 5 boys and 3 girls.
To determine the number of ways a boy and a girl can be selected from a group of 5 boys and 3 girls to attend a conference, we can use the concept of combinations.
The number of ways to choose one boy from 5 boys is 5C1, which is equal to 5. Similarly, the number of ways to choose one girl from 3 girls is 3C1, which is equal to 3.
To select one boy and one girl, we need to multiply the number of ways to choose a boy and a girl together. Using the multiplication principle, we multiply the number of choices for each category: 5C1 * 3C1 = 5 * 3 = 15.
Therefore, there are 15 ways to select a boy and a girl from the given group to attend the conference.
Each combination represents a unique pair consisting of one boy and one girl. For example, if the boys are labeled as B1, B2, B3, B4, and B5, and the girls are labeled as G1, G2, and G3, the possible pairs could be (B1, G1), (B1, G2), (B1, G3), (B2, G1), (B2, G2), and so on, up to (B5, G3).

Salinas Corporation has net income of $15 million per year on net sales of $90 million per year. It currently has no long-term debt but is considering a debt issue of $20 million. The interest rate on the debt would be 7%. Salinas Corp. currently faces an effective tax rate of 40%. What would be the annual interest tax shield to Salinas Corp. if it goes through with the debt issuance?
Answer:
The annual interest tax shield to Salinas Corp would be of $560,000
Step-by-step explanation:
In order to calculate the annual interest tax shield to Salinas Corp if it goes through with the debt issuance we would have to calculate the following formula:
Annual Interest tax shield = Interest * tax
Interest = debt *rate of interest
Interest=$20 million * 0.07
Interest= $ 1.40 million
tax= 40%
Therefore, Annual Interest tax shield =$1.40 million * 0.40
Annual Interest tax shield = $560,000
The annual interest tax shield to Salinas Corp would be of $560,000
